WebOct 19, 2016 · The Mosta Dome is perhaps the most impressive church in Malta, with its’ massive rotunda, that is the third largest in the world. The Mosta Dome church was built in 1860. During the Second World War, the church was almost destroyed when, during an air raid, a 200kg bomb fell through the dome without exploding.
